Matthew Oates’ portraits explore the mutations of perception that take place within human interactions. Created originally from people he has encountered, each persona enters an alternate world where characteristics can be amplified and represented visually without regard for the perils of the world of the viewer. These individuals look back out at us and a new interaction is created that challenges the traditional relationship between observer and image.
Matthew Oates has exhibited in and around Boston and New York at the deCordova Sculpture Park and Museum, The Distillery, School of the Museum of Fine Arts, Limner Gallery and The Boston Center for Psychoanalysis. He is the recipient of several awards including the Lawrence Kupferman Memorial Award, the George Nick Prize and the Rob Moore Memorial Grant. His work has been published in Coming Soon Zine and Direct Art magazine. He has toured and performed around the country with musical projects: Phantom Glue and Nodule. Matthew works and lives in Newbury, New Hampshire with his wife and two daughters.
